Why proper sizing of changes matters

Optimal pull request sizes drive a better predictable PR flow as they strike a
balance between between PR complexity and PR review overhead. PRs within the
optimal size (typical small, or medium sized PRs) mean:

  • Fast and predictable releases to production:
    • Optimal size changes are more likely to be reviewed faster with fewer
      iterations.
    • Similarity in low PR complexity drives similar review times.
  • Review quality is likely higher as complexity is lower:
    • Bugs are more likely to be detected.
    • Code inconsistencies are more likely to be detected.
  • Knowledge sharing is improved within the participants:
    • Small portions can be assimilated better.
  • Better engineering practices are exercised:
    • Solving big problems by dividing them in well contained, smaller problems.
    • Exercising separation of concerns within the code changes.

How to interpret the change counts in git diff output

  • One line was added: +1 -0
  • One line was deleted: +0 -1
  • One line was modified: +1 -1 (git diff doesn't know about modified, it will
    interpret that line like one addition plus one deletion)
  • Change percentiles: Change characteristics (addition, deletion, modification)
    of this PR in relation to all other PRs within the repository.
